replaced old 3620 after it said replace ink pad., but was printing fine, purchase a new identical 3620 printer loaded DVD fine, but would not initialize. Brought new printer over to another win 7 computer, DVD loaded and printer printed. Tried uninstalling drivers, tried different ports,replacing usb cable, loaded driver from Canon instead of the one that came with the cd.. Called Canon Tech support, and after 1 hour, tech said "call Microsoft".
I am stumped, please I need your wonderful solutions.
